TOMORROW: EPA Administrator to Testify on Public Health and Drinking Water Issues
Release Date: 02/01/2011
Contact Information: EPA Press Office, press@epa.gov, 202-564-6794
WASHINGTON – U.S. EPA Administrator Lisa P. Jackson will testify before the U.S. Senate Committee on Environment and Public Works tomorrow on EPA’s role in addressing public health concerns related to drinking water issues. She will be joined by Linda Birnbaum, Ph.D., D.A.B.T., A.T.S., director of the National Institutes of Environmental Health Sciences.
Hearing details:
WHO: EPA Administrator Lisa P. Jackson
WHAT: Testifying before the Senate Committee on Environment and Public Works
WHEN: 10:00 a.m., Wednesday, February 2, 2011
WHERE: 406 Dirken Senate Office Building, Washington, D.C.
